Abstract
Stavudine is a nucleoside analogue used for the treatment of HIV-1 infection, as part of highly active antiretroviral treatment. In developing countries, stavudine is used widely, owing to low cost and inclusion in generic fixed-dose combinations. In developed countries, stavudine is now rarely used, although it is highly effective. This is because newer drugs show lower rates of mitochondrial toxicities, such as lipoatrophy, peripheral neuropathy and lactic acidosis. In the development of stavudine, there was evidence that a dosage of 20-30 mg b.i.d. was effective, but the 40-mg b.i.d. dose gained regulatory approval. This review analyses the clinical trials conducted before and after the regulatory approval of stavudine, and shows that the dose of 30 mg b.i.d. has equivalent antiviral efficacy (given the caveats of meta-analysis), with some evidence of lower rates of peripheral neuropathy and lipoatrophy. With limited resources for HIV-1 treatment in developing countries, and only 25% of eligible patients receiving highly active antiretroviral treatment, low-cost treatment options such as stavudine still need to be pursued, if safety can be improved by dose optimisation.

Abstract
BACKGROUND The administration of antiretroviral therapy to lactating women could represent a possible strategy to reduce postnatal HIV transmission. In this study, we assessed the effect of antiretroviral treatment on breast milk viral load and determined plasma and breast milk drug concentrations in pregnant women receiving highly active antiretroviral therapy (HAART). METHODS We studied 40 women receiving zidovudine, lamivudine, and nevirapine from 28 weeks of gestation to 1 month postpartum (group A) and 40 untreated pregnant women (group B). Blood and breast milk samples were collected at delivery and 7 days postpartum. RESULTS Women in group A had received a median of 85 days of therapy before delivery. Median breast milk concentrations of nevirapine, lamivudine, and zidovudine were 0.6, 1.8, and 1.1 times, respectively, those in maternal plasma. HIV RNA levels in breast milk were significantly lower in group A than in group B (median of 2.3 vs. 3.4 log at delivery and 1.9 vs. 3.6 log at day 7; P < 0.001 for both comparisons). CONCLUSIONS Antiretroviral drugs administered during the last trimester of pregnancy and after delivery reach levels similar to or higher than plasma concentrations in breast milk and can significantly reduce HIV RNA levels. Our data support the potential role of maternal HAART prophylaxis in reducing the risk of breast-feeding-associated transmission.

Abstract
OBJECTIVE To characterize changes in regional anthropometry associated with stavudine exposure and discontinuation. DESIGN Seven hundred thirty-four HIV-infected participants who reported using stavudine (574 of whom later discontinued stavudine) and 698 HIV-uninfected participants from the Women's Interagency HIV Study provided anthropometrics at 8706 semiannual visits between July 1999 and March 2005. METHODS Changes in weight, waist, chest, upper arm, hip, and midthigh circumferences were evaluated using linear regression with generalized estimating equations. RESULTS HIV-uninfected women demonstrated increases in regional anthropometry at every body site, whereas HIV-infected women demonstrated decreases in weight and circumferences of the waist, chest, hip, and thigh. A smaller annual decrease in hip circumference was seen after discontinuing stavudine for >2.25 years compared with the decrease observed while on stavudine (P = 0.01). Discontinuing stavudine for >2.25 years was associated with smaller (P < 0.05) decreases in hip (-0.06 cm/y) and thigh (-0.005 cm/y) circumference compared with the decreases observed between 1 and 2.25 years (hip: -0.46 cm/y, thigh: -0.24 cm/y) or < or =1 year (hip: -0.64 cm/y, thigh: -0.27 cm/y) after stavudine discontinuation. CONCLUSIONS Regardless of continuing or discontinuing stavudine, HIV-infected women demonstrate decreases in weight and body circumference measurements over time. The lower limb seems to be most affected by stavudine exposure, with stabilization observed more than 2 years after discontinuation.

Abstract
OBJECTIVE Stavudine (d4T), a nucleoside reverse-transcriptase inhibitor (NRTI), can induce lipoatrophy, fatty liver, hyperlactataemia and abnormal liver tests. NRTI toxicity is usually ascribed to mitochondrial DNA (mtDNA) depletion and impaired mitochondrial respiration. However, NRTIs could have effects unrelated to mtDNA. Recently, we reported that 100 mg/kg/day of d4T stimulated fatty acid oxidation (FAO) in mouse liver, and reduced body fatness without depleting white adipose tissue (WAT) mtDNA. We hypothesized that higher d4T doses could further reduce adiposity, while inhibiting hepatic FAO. METHODS Mice were treated for 2 weeks with d4T (500 mg/kg/day), L-carnitine (200 mg/kg/day) or both drugs concomitantly. Body fatness was assessed by dual energy X-ray absorptiometry, and investigations were performed in plasma, liver, muscle and WAT. RESULTS D4T reduced the gain of body adiposity, WAT leptin, whole body FAO and plasma ketone bodies, and increased liver triglycerides and plasma aminotransferases with mild ultrastructural abnormalities in hepatocytes. Plasma lactate and respiratory chain activities in tissues were unchanged. Stearoyl-CoA desaturase (SCD-1), an enzyme negatively regulated by leptin, was overexpressed in liver. High doses of beta-aminoisobutyric acid (BAIBA), a d4T catabolite, increased plasma ketone bodies. Although L-carnitine did not correct body adiposity, it prevented d4T-induced impairment of FAO and liver abnormalities. CONCLUSIONS D4T overdosage triggers fat wasting, leptin insufficiency and mild liver damage, without causing respiratory chain dysfunction. Overexpression of SCD-1 reduces fatty acid oxidation and overcomes the stimulating effect of BAIBA on hepatic FAO. L-carnitine does not correct leptin insufficiency but prevents d4T-induced impairment of FAO and liver damage.

Abstract
OBJECTIVE To investigate nevirapine concentrations in African HIV-infected children receiving divided Triomune tablets (stavudine+lamivudine+nevirapine). DESIGN Cross-sectional study. METHODS Steady-state plasma nevirapine concentrations were determined in Malawian and Zambian children aged 8 months to 18 years receiving Triomune in routine outpatient settings. Predictors from height-for-age, body mass index (BMI)-for-age, age, sex, post-dose sampling time and dose/m2/day were investigated using centre-stratified regression with backwards elimination (P<0.1). RESULTS Of the 71 Malawian and 56 Zambian children (median age 8.4 vs 8.5 years, height-for-age -3.15 vs -1.84, respectively), only 1 (3%) of those prescribed > or =300 mg/m2/day nevirapine had subtherapeutic concentrations (<3 mg/l) compared with 22 (23%) of those prescribed <300 mg/m2/day; most children with subtherapeutic nevirapine concentrations were taking half or quarter Triomune tablets. Lower nevirapine concentrations were independently associated with lower height-for-age (indicating stunting) (0.37 mg/l per unit higher [95% confidence interval (CI): -0.003, +0.74]; P=0.05), lower prescribed dose/m2 (+0.89 mg/l per 50 mg/m2 higher [95% CI: 0.32, 1.46]; P=0.002) and higher BMI-for-age (indicating lack of wasting) (-0.42 mg/l per unit higher [95% CI: -0.80, -0.04]; P=0.03). CONCLUSIONS Currently available adult fixed-dose combination tablets are not well suited to children, particularly at younger ages: Triomune 30 is preferable to Triomune 40 because of the higher dose of nevirapine relative to stavudine. Further research is required to confirm that concentrations are reduced in stunted children but increased in wasted children. Development of appropriate paediatric fixed-dose combination tablets is essential if antiretroviral therapy is to be made widely available to children in resource-limited settings.

Abstract
BACKGROUND The antiretroviral treatment (ART) combination of stavudine, lamivudine and nevirapine (d4T/3TC/NVP) is the most frequently used initial regimen in many Asian countries. There are few data on the outcome of this treatment in clinic cohorts in this region. METHODS We selected patients from the TREAT Asia HIV Observational Database (TAHOD) who started their first ART regimen with d4T/3TC/NVP. Treatment change was defined as cessation of therapy or the addition or change of one or more drugs. Clinical failure was defined as diagnosis with an AIDS-defining illness, or death while on d4T/3TC/NVP treatment. RESULTS The rate of treatment change among TAHOD patients starting d4T/3TC/NVP as their first antiretroviral treatment was 22.3 per 100 person-years, with lower baseline haemoglobin (i.e. anaemia) associated with slower rate of treatment change. The rate of clinical failure while on d4T/3TC/NVP treatment was 7.3 per 100 person-years, with baseline CD4 cell count significantly associated with clinical failure. After d4T/3TC/NVP was stopped, nearly 40% of patients did not restart any treatment and, of those who changed to other treatment, the majority changed to zidovudine (ZDV)/3TC/NVP and less than 3% of patients changed to a protease inhibitor (PI)-containing regimen. The rates of disease progression on the second-line regimen were similar to those on the first-line regimen. CONCLUSION These real-life data provide an insight into clinical practice in Asia and the Pacific region. d4T/3TC/NVP is maintained longer than other first-line regimens and change is mainly as a result of adverse effects rather than clinical failure. There is a need to develop affordable second-line antiretroviral treatment options for patients with HIV infection in developing countries.

Abstract
BACKGROUND The tuberculosis (TB) mortality rate of registered TB patients in Malawi is 23%, and 59% of the deaths occur in the first 2 months of treatment. HIV-related complications appear to be an important cause. Starting antiretroviral therapy early during tuberculosis treatment may improve outcome but problems often arise with drug interactions, adherence, toxicity and immune reconstitution disease (IRD). METHODS We prospectively followed 27 HIV-infected adult Malawians after starting Triomune (a generic fixed drug combination of stavudine, lamivudine and nevirapine) in the second week of tuberculosis treatment. RESULTS At baseline, 88% had CD4+ T-cell counts <100 cells/ml, all were anaemic and 78% were malnourished. Five patients (19%) died, two withdrew consent and one stopped all drugs due to hepatitis. At 6 months, all but one of the 19 remaining patients had good virological results (16 patients: <400 copies/ml, two patients: <1,000 copies/ml) and the median CD4+ T cell increase was 170 cells/ml. Adverse events were numerous, particularly in the first 2 months. Suspected IRD episodes could be managed without treatment interruptions. During the lead-in phase, 59% of nevirapine plasma levels were sub-therapeutic despite good adherence, compared with only 14% during weeks 4 and 8. CONCLUSION It is feasible to start Triomune early during TB treatment with good treatment outcome. The nevirapine lead-in phase should be avoided when rifampicin-based tuberculosis treatment is started >1 week beforehand.

Abstract
OBJECTIVE As part of the large international, randomized 2NN trial, the pharmacokinetics of nevirapine in once-daily 400 mg and twice-daily 200 mg dosing regimens were investigated. METHOD Treatment-naive HIV-1-infected patients were randomized to receive nevirapine 400 mg once daily or 200 mg twice daily, in combination with lamivudine and stavudine. Blood samples were collected at several time-points (day 3, weeks 1, 2, 4, 24, and 48). Differences in pharmacokinetics between once- versus twice-daily dosing were investigated with nonlinear mixed effects modelling (NONMEM). RESULTS In total, 2,899 nevirapine plasma concentrations were available from 578 patients. Dosage and dosing frequency did not influence clearance or volume of distribution of nevirapine, indicating linear pharmacokinetic behavior of nevirapine whether given as a single daily dose or as divided doses over 24 hours. During steady state, the Cmin was lower (3.26 mg/L vs. 4.44 mg/L; p < .001) and the Cmax was higher (7.88 mg/L vs. 6.55 mg/L; p < .001) in the once-daily arm. However, compared to total variability in nevirapine levels for both treatments, these differences were minor. During steady state, total exposure, measured as AUC24h, was comparable for both regimens (133 mg/L*h vs. 133 mg/L*h; p = .084). CONCLUSION The daily exposure to nevirapine (AUC24h) was similar for the 400 mg once-daily and the 200 mg twice-daily dosing regimens. The Cmin of nevirapine is lower and the Cmax of nevirapine is higher for the once-daily regimen as compared to the twice-daily regimen. As a result, 200 mg nevirapine dosed twice daily may be preferred over 400 mg nevirapine dosed once daily.

Abstract
BACKGROUND A favourable regimen for people infected with HIV/AIDS is one that provides optimal efficacy, durability of antiretroviral activity, tolerability, and has low adverse effects and drug-drug interactions. The combination of the non-nucleoside reverse transcriptase inhibitor nevirapine (NVP), and two nucleoside reverse transcriptase inhibitors, stavudine (d4T) and lamivudine (3TC), is widely used as first-line therapy, especially in low-resource countries. Analysis of the efficacy, durability and tolerability of the regimen is thus important to clinicians, consumers and policy-makers living in both rich and poor countries. OBJECTIVES To examine the efficacy of the stavudine, lamivudine and nevirapine regimen for the treatment of HIV infection and AIDS in adults. SEARCH STRATEGY We used the comprehensive search strategy developed specifically by the Cochrane HIV/AIDS Review Group to identify HIV/AIDS randomised controlled trials, and searched the following electronic databases: MEDLINE (searched July 2004); Embase (searched October 2004); and CENTRAL (July 2004). This search was supplemented with a search of AIDSearch (April 2005) to identify relevant conference abstracts, as well as searching reference lists of all eligible articles. The search was not limited by language or publication status. SELECTION CRITERIA Randomised controlled trials of the stavudine, lamivudine and nevirapine regimen, compared with any other regimens for treating HIV/AIDS, in antiretroviral treatment-naive or antiretroviral treatment-experienced adults. DATA COLLECTION AND ANALYSIS Two reviewers independently assessed the methodological quality of the trials and extracted data. MAIN RESULTS Our search resulted in 1,148 records, of which two studies described trials that met our inclusion criteria. One trial was a small single-centre Australian trial of 70 antiretroviral-naive participants, while the other trial was a large, multicentre trial, conducted in 14 countries, of 1,216 antiretroviral-naive participants. In both trials over 60% of participants were male. As the therapeutic combinations compared in both trials were not identical, it was not possible to conduct a meta-analysis to increase the power of the results. The main findings, therefore, are from the much larger trial, which was of a high quality. This trial found that there was no statistically significant difference in the efficacy (measured by treatment failure) between nevirapine and efavirenz (EFZ), when used in combination with 3TC and d4T (RR = 1.16; 95%CI: 0.95, 1.41). There was no statistically significant difference between once daily or twice-daily dosing of NVP, when used in combination with 3TC and d4T (RR = 1.00; 95%CI: 0.83; 1.21). It also showed that, compared with NVP plus EFZ, 3TC and d4T, a once-daily dosing of NVP, in combination with 3TC and d4T, performs better in averting treatment failure (RR = 0.82; 95%CI: 0.67, 1.00) than does twice-daily dosing of NVP with 3TC and d4T (RR = 0.82; 95%CI: 0.69; 0.97). Frequency of toxicity was higher in participants receiving NVP, compared with EFZ. AUTHORS' CONCLUSIONS The combination of nevirapine, 3TC and d4T is as efficacious as a combination of efavirenz, 3TC and d4T. Once-daily NVP with twice-daily 3TC and d4T is as efficacious as twice-daily NVP, 3TC and d4T. However, toxicity may be increased in the once-daily NVP regime. Additional trials of sufficient duration are required to provide better evidence for the use of this combination as a first line therapy. Ideally, trials should use standardised assessment measures especially with respect to measuring viral load, so that results can be compared and combined in meta-analyses.

Abstract
Patients infected with HIV-1 with more than 1000 HIV-1 RNA copies/mL, who were genotyped within 3 months before starting stavudine and treated for at least 3 months with a stable stavudine-containing highly active antiretroviral therapy, were selected from our database to identify the determinants of response to stavudine. Nonresponse was defined as a failure to achieve HIV-1 RNA level of less than 400 copies/mL or a reduction of more than 2 log10 by week 12. Univariate logistic analysis was used to elicit the failure-associated reverse transcriptase mutations (scored 1 to develop a genotype score). Eighty-one patients were eligible for the analysis, including 75 (93%) who previously received zidovudine. Thirty-five (43%) were nonresponders. Univariate logistic analysis revealed the following failure-associated mutations: 41L (P = 0.0001), 44D (P = 0.02), 118I (P = 0.0006), 184V (P = 0.04), 210W (P = 0.0004), and 215Y (P = 0.002) for a median stavudine score of 2. Failure was observed in 7 (18.9%) of 37 patients with a score less than 2, compared with 28 (63.6%) of 44 patients with a score of 2 or greater (P < 0.0001). The multivariable analysis showed that the 118I mutation (P = 0.04) was the only independent genotypic predictor of failing on a stavudine- containing highly active antiretroviral therapy.
